Exploring the Interplay Between Truth, Beauty, and Plato's Influence

The chapter explores different viewpoints on how truth and beauty mediate between each other, discussing Keats' statement 'if truth is beauty, beauty is truth' and its implications on the concept of beauty as the highest virtue. The conversation delves into the influence of Platonism, plagiarism, and the possibility of academia offering a limited perspective on Plato's beliefs.
